The World Laparoscopy Training Institute in Orlando continues to stand as a global leader in minimally invasive surgical education. The March 2026 batch marked another milestone in excellence, bringing together surgeons, gynecologists, and urologists from across the world for an intensive, hands-on learning experience in laparoscopic and robotic surgery.

The program commenced with a comprehensive orientation that introduced participants to the latest advancements in minimally invasive techniques. The curriculum was carefully structured to balance theoretical knowledge with practical exposure, ensuring that each trainee gained both confidence and competence. Interactive lectures covered essential topics such as surgical ergonomics, patient safety, advanced energy sources, and complication management.

One of the most remarkable highlights of the March 2026 batch was the extensive hands-on training. Participants had the opportunity to practice on high-fidelity simulators and perform procedures under expert supervision. The use of modern simulation labs allowed trainees to refine their skills in suturing, knotting, and intracorporeal techniques—critical components of laparoscopic surgery.

A major attraction of the program was the exposure to robotic surgery. Trainees were introduced to cutting-edge robotic systems, where they observed and practiced console-based procedures. This experience helped bridge the gap between conventional laparoscopy and the future of surgical innovation, making the training highly relevant in today’s evolving medical landscape.

Live surgery sessions were another key feature of the batch. Participants observed real-time procedures performed by experienced faculty, gaining insight into decision-making, operative strategies, and patient management. These sessions were highly interactive, allowing trainees to ask questions and engage in discussions, thereby enhancing their clinical understanding.

The fellowship examination conducted at the end of the program ensured that participants met international standards of proficiency. Successful candidates were awarded globally recognized certifications, adding significant value to their professional careers.

Beyond academics, the program also fostered a spirit of global collaboration. Surgeons from diverse cultural and professional backgrounds shared experiences, exchanged ideas, and built lasting professional networks. This collaborative environment enriched the overall learning experience and promoted the exchange of best practices in minimally invasive surgery.

The March 2026 batch concluded with a grand convocation ceremony, celebrating the achievements of the participants. It was a moment of pride and accomplishment, reflecting their dedication and hard work throughout the program.

In conclusion, the March 2026 batch at the World Laparoscopy Training Institute exemplified excellence in surgical education. With its blend of advanced technology, expert mentorship, and hands-on training, the institute continues to shape the future of minimally invasive surgery worldwide.
